Monsoon Accessorize ends use of angora wool

By Vivian Hendriksz

loading...

Scroll down to read more
Monsoon Accessorize, the UK-based fashion retailer which operates three brands, has decided to “end the use of angora in all future production” of its apparel and accessories.

The decision to cut angora out of it collection comes after animal rights group Peta, revealed its under-cover investigation into angora fur farms in China, which highlighted the ongoing animal cruelty behind the practice.

“Following concerns raised about the treatment of angora rabbits in Chinese farms, during 2013-14, we conducted detailed audits of the farms used by our suppliers,” said Monsoon Accessorize in a statement. “These audits confirmed that live plucking was not used anywhere in our supply chain.”

“However, despite the above, we recognise that some of our customers still feel uncomfortable with the continued inclusion of angora in our ranges.” Therefore the retailer has decided to stop using angora. Monsoon Accessorize has joined a growing list of global fashion brands, including Asos, Stella McCartney and French Connection, banning the use of angora.
